I am trying to get .sortable
from jQuery UI to work but it is only working for my first item, when I dynamically add new ones, it stops working.
I found this: http://api.jqueryui.com/sortable/#method-refresh which should refresh everything and recognize new items, but when I use that I get the error:
Uncaught Error: cannot call methods on sortable prior to initialization; attempted to call method 'refresh'
What can I do?
My code:

If I remove the line that says refresh in my function and only have the one .sortable
in my code then I can drag all items even new ones but nothing is dropping. So I can drag but not sort/drop.

I think this is on where you attach your sort. I used a wrapper here to do so.
Note I turned off the refresh due to where I attached it as it seems to not need that given that attachment point.

$('#addcategory').on('click', function() {
let t = $(template)
$('#dynamic_field').append(t);
updatePlaceholders();
});
$(function() {
$('#addcategory').trigger('click');
$('#dynamic_field').sortable();
});
